About the Book

What if every murder was just a piece of a much larger plan... and time was running out?

With each passing day, new victims fall under increasingly mysterious circumstances. European capitals tremble, and no one seems able to stop the killer. Without a hero capable of deciphering the code behind these murders, the world risks being overwhelmed by a horror no one can imagine.

In "Clock of Blood", follow Leonard Greco, a former Interpol profiler, as he faces a ruthless killer who leaves only cryptic clues: broken clocks, stopped at the exact same, enigmatic hour. This suspense-filled thriller takes you on a race against time, through deception, puzzles, and shocking twists, ultimately revealing the truth behind an ancient conspiracy.
